Flir ioi TRK-101-P PTZ Tracker Specification
The TRK-101-P supports a wide range of PTZ camera models and can be configured to track multiple objects simultaneously, adapting to various security scenarios. It features network connectivity for remote configuration and monitoring, ensuring flexibility and ease of integration into existing surveillance systems. The tracker operates efficiently under diverse lighting conditions, thanks to its advanced image processing capabilities, which include features like background subtraction and shadow removal.
Its robust architecture ensures reliable performance, and it is designed for easy installation and maintenance, minimizing downtime and operational disruptions. The TRK-101-P is engineered to deliver high accuracy and responsiveness, making it suitable for critical security applications in environments such as airports, borders, and industrial facilities. It supports various communication protocols, ensuring compatibility with standard video management systems, and offers comprehensive event management capabilities to alert operators of potential threats.
Overall, the Flir ioi TRK-101-P PTZ Tracker provides an intelligent solution for enhancing situational awareness and security efficiency, leveraging the power of automated video analytics to deliver precise and actionable insights.
Flir ioi TRK-101-P PTZ Tracker F.A.Q.
How do I set up the Flir ioi TRK-101-P for the first time?
To set up the Flir ioi TRK-101-P, connect the device to a power source and a network. Access the web interface through the device's IP address.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the initial configuration, including setting the time, date, and network parameters.
What are the steps to troubleshoot connectivity issues with the TRK-101-P?
First, ensure that all cables are securely connected. Verify the device's IP address and network settings. Check if the network has any restrictions or firewalls that might block communication. Restart the device and check for any firmware updates that might resolve connectivity issues.
How can I update the firmware on the TRK-101-P?
To update the firmware, access the device's web interface. Navigate to the firmware update section, and upload the latest firmware file provided by Flir. Follow the prompts to complete the update process, ensuring the device remains powered on throughout.
What maintenance is required to keep the TRK-101-P in optimal condition?
Regularly clean the camera lens and housing to prevent dust accumulation. Check cables and connections for wear and tear. Update the firmware periodically. Perform a system check every few months to ensure all components are functioning properly.
How do I configure motion detection on the TRK-101-P?
Access the device's web interface and navigate to the motion detection settings. Define the areas to be monitored and set the sensitivity levels. Save your settings and test the configuration to ensure accurate detection.
Can the TRK-101-P be integrated with third-party security systems?
Yes, the TRK-101-P supports ONVIF and other standard protocols, allowing integration with various third-party security systems. Consult the device's integration guide for detailed instructions on setting up compatibility.
What should I do if the camera does not pan or tilt properly?
Check if there are any physical obstructions preventing movement. Ensure the device is receiving adequate power. Access the web interface to recalibrate the pan/tilt mechanism. If issues persist, consider resetting the device to factory settings.
How can I set up alerts for specific events on the TRK-101-P?
In the web interface, go to the events and alerts section. Define the events you want to be alerted about, such as motion detection or tampering. Configure the alert method, whether via email, SMS, or another notification system.
How do I reset the TRK-101-P to its factory settings?
To reset the TRK-101-P, locate the reset button on the device. Press and hold the button for about 10 seconds until the device reboots. This will restore all settings to factory defaults.
What are the recommended environmental conditions for operating the TRK-101-P?
The TRK-101-P is designed to operate within a temperature range of -40°C to 55°C (-40°F to 131°F). It should be installed in a location where it is protected from direct exposure to extreme weather conditions to ensure longevity and reliability.
